Show ; Many new-comers . arc attracted at-tracted to Park City's snow and skiing. But not so Donna Lewis formerly a non-skier, w h o left the r a t-race of Southern California to enjoy the pace and life style typified in Utah. . Leaving her" design studio., her responsibilities in civic affairs and . A AUW Presidency behind her,- Donna packed up children and house pel s 3 '? .years - ago and responded to her need for a life-style change. . After : one Year in the Salt Lake valley, i he owner of Park City's Inside Story decided that Park. City's mountain atmosphere, sense of community, and history was i he "place to call home". The consequence? Donna Lewis now operates a design studio, gift shop, and expresses her co m m i I me n t to community affairs!! - The daughter of an interior designer. Donna feels that her current occupation is almost intuitive., and. perhaps even inherited from her father! Sharing his: interest and talent in space, color, environment, and people she quickly learn-, cd the trade. Although most of Donna's career commitment has been in thcarea of'interior design, she includes elementary element-ary school tcaching.the ..importing; exporting and distributing dis-tributing of Mexican textiles; and an assortment of other "people oriented" jobs on her vita. Donna decided to return to the design trade when she learned that 586 Main Street was for sale and converted the former mortuary into the Inside Story in 1979. Eager to reflect the history and character char-acter of Park City in the shop, its contents combine antique and contemporary furnishings and accessories. The store, whose woodburning stove and dogs contribute to its cozy atmosphere, contains a full bath boutique, a gourmet shop, home accessories, drap-erv drap-erv and wall coverings, and . furnishings! Because of the limited space Donna is selective select-ive about the items she : displays, but quickly emphasizes empha-sizes that special orders from a multitude of venders is possible Considerate of the needs of the local shopper and. tourists, the shop contains unique items at reasonable prices. In addition to the gift-accessory gift-accessory shop Donna maintains main-tains a full design gallery and provides consultation in interior inter-ior design. Experience and reputation makes the Inside Story capable of purchasing items to complete any household. house-hold. Donna stresses the importance of "responding to the environment created by the specific people who create it", and combines new items and color with existing furnishing furn-ishing and architecture to create that special look.
